Too bad the camera caught you in France – Brazil game watching live in the stadium. Youri was a member of the 1998 France champion team, asked his current club—New York Red Bulls that he needed to leave them to attend to a personal matter at home.
The team said they granted his leave request just as any player who needs to take care of personal matters; but they were not told he was attending the match as part of his leave request. The team’s spokesman said they will address the situation right away.
